Solution for 3-6x=19+2x equation:


Simplifying
3 + -6x = 19 + 2x

Solving
3 + -6x = 19 + 2x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2x' to each side of the equation.
3 + -6x + -2x = 19 + 2x + -2x

Combine like terms: -6x + -2x = -8x
3 + -8x = 19 + 2x + -2x

Combine like terms: 2x + -2x = 0
3 + -8x = 19 + 0
3 + -8x = 19

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+ -3 + -8x = 19 + -3

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+ -8x = 19 + -3
-8x = 19 + -3

Combine like terms: 19 + -3 = 16
-8x = 16

Divide each side by '-8'.
x = -2

Simplifying
x = -2
